WebOne way to try to reduce the cost of medical care in the United States for foreigners is to research the cost of care in advance. This can be done by contacting hospitals and doctor’s offices directly and asking for estimates of the cost of care for specific procedures. WebForeign residents in the U.K. must have an NHS number to make routine appointments with a General Practitioner (GP). To get an NHS number, international residents must register with a GP or make an appointment with their local health authority. International Insurance International insurance is popular for expats who live in the United States. It’s also generally known as offshore insurance or expat insurance. As the name suggests, this type of insurance is created mainly for expats. WebApr 13, 2024 · Chlamydia is one of the most common STDs in the United States, and it often has no symptoms. It can cause serious health problems if left untreated, including pelvic inflammatory disease (PID) and infertility.
